Shrimp Cakes

These patties will seem very loose even after cooling for an hour. If you carefully place them in the frying pan, they will stay together. They can be cooked a little ahead and reheated in the oven at 325 degrees.
- 4
Ingredients
- 1 pound medium sh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 1 cup finely chopped red bell pepper
- 1 garlic clove, chopped (optional. I usually don’t add)
- 1/4 cup thinly sliced green onions
- 3 tablespoons mayonnaise
- 1/2 teaspoon s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 large egg
- 3/4 cup panko,divided
- Oil for frying
Preparation
Step 1
1. Cut shrimp into small pieces, about 4-5 pieces per shrimp.
2. Heat a large skillet over medium heat. Coat pan with cooking spray. Add bell pepper to pan, saute 3 minutes. Add garlic, saute 1 minute. Remove from heat. Place bell pepper mixture in a large bowl. (I’ve skipped this step, as well.)
3. Add shrimp, green onions and next ingredients up to and including the egg, stirring well. Add 1/4 cup panko.
4. Divide mixture into 1/2 inch thick patties. Dredge both sides with remaining 1/2 cup panko. (Mixture will be very "mushy", but it will firm up when refrigerated.)
5. Chill at least 1 hour.
6. Heat pan over medium heat. Coat bottom of a frying pan with about a half inch of oil Cook patties 4 minutes on each side or until done. Place on a paper towel to drain.
7. Keep warm. Serve with cocktail sauce or salsa of your choice. It’s really good with Parmesan aioli.
